Clickpotato Virus Description:

Clickpotato drops many ads onto your browser when it is installed. Therefore, don’t download this program no matter how useful it boosts itself. If you download this program on the computer by chance, you need to remove it as soon as possible. Otherwise, you can encounter many bad things. To begin with Clickpotato is an adware, which means that it is an ad-supported application. It will flood the browser with countless advertisements and pop-up windows every now and then.


The pop-up ads will show up on every website that you are visiting. Therefore, you may be fooled to think that the ads are related to the website and click on them by mistake. After clicked on the ads, you will be redirected to some suspicious websites, where contain many porn content and pop-ups. At that time, your computer probably suffers from other similar malware attacks, which include Trojan viruses, Ransowmare, or rogue programs. All in all, it is very important for you to get rid of Clickpotato adware completely from the computer if you don’t want to get involved in more troubles.

Clickpotato Virus Is a Trouble Maker:

It penetrates into computers and hijacks browsers;
It changes browser settings and installs unwanted add-ons;
It generates pop-up ads and makes legitimate pages a big mess;
It consumes system resources and slows down system performance;
It tracks browser histories secretly and leaks out the data to others.

Method Two: Clickpotato Virus Manual Removal
It is suggested that you back up system files before manual removal. Any slight mistake may cause more damage. Hence, you need to be very careful during removal process.
Step 1: Disable unwanted start-up items.
Hit Win and R keys on the keyboard together. At the opening, run box, type into the command msconfig and click OK button.

In the System Configuration Utility window, navigate to Startup tab and disable suspicious items including Clickpotato that may cause pop-up ads.

Step 2: Remove suspicious programs.
Enter Control Panel via Start Menu. Click Uninstall a program.

Check out all programs and remove the programs that you don’t know.

Step 3: Show hidden files and remove the files related Clickpotato virus.
Click Starts and choose Control Panel. Click Appearance and Personalization and then click Folder Options.

In the View tab, check the checkbox of Show hidden files, folders and drives.

Find out malicious files outlined below and remove them all together.

Step 4: Clean all browsing histories and cookies.
a. For Google Chrome
Open Chrome, click Chrome Menu button and select History. Click Clear browsing data… button.

Clean the items including Browsing history, Cookies and other site and plug-in data and Passwords from “the beginning of time”.

b. For Internet Explorer
Open IE, click Tools and then select Internet Options.

In General tab, click Delete button at Browsing history section.

Then click Delete button.

c. For Mozilla Firefox
Open Firefox, click Tools on Firefox Menu Bar and choose Clean Recent History.

At the popup window, select Everything from drop-down menu of Time range to clear. Next, click Details then tick Cookies and click Clear Now button.

Step 5: Restart Windows system. Click Start button and tap Shutdown then tab Restart.
